Worse

(1):
(n.) Loss; disadvantage; defeat.
(2):
(compar.) Bad, ill, evil, or corrupt, in a greater degree; more bad or evil; less good; specifically, in poorer health; more sick; - used both in a physical and moral sense.
(3):
(n.) That which is worse; something less good; as, think not the worse of him for his enterprise.
(4):
(a.) In a worse degree; in a manner more evil or bad.
(5):
(v. t.) To make worse; to put disadvantage; to discomfit; to worst. See Worst, v.
